Masayuki Hagiwara is a scholar working on Condensed Matter Physics, Electronic, Optical and Magnetic Materials and Materials Chemistry. According to data from OpenAlex, Masayuki Hagiwara has authored 381 papers receiving a total of 5.6k indexed citations (citations by other indexed papers that have themselves been cited), including 302 papers in Condensed Matter Physics, 295 papers in Electronic, Optical and Magnetic Materials and 59 papers in Materials Chemistry. Recurrent topics in Masayuki Hagiwara’s work include Physics of Superconductivity and Magnetism (176 papers), Advanced Condensed Matter Physics (169 papers) and Magnetism in coordination complexes (106 papers). Masayuki Hagiwara is often cited by papers focused on Physics of Superconductivity and Magnetism (176 papers), Advanced Condensed Matter Physics (169 papers) and Magnetism in coordination complexes (106 papers). Masayuki Hagiwara collaborates with scholars based in Japan, United States and France. Masayuki Hagiwara's co-authors include Koichi Kindo, K. Katsumata, Shojiro Kimura, Yasuo Narumi, Takanori Kida, Tetsuya Takeuchi, Jean‐Pierre Renard, Ian Affleck, Bertrand I. Halperin and Hironori Yamaguchi and has published in prestigious journals such as Science, Proceedings of the National Academy of Sciences and Physical Review Letters.
